RIDGE STREET SCHOOL Student Reporting Recommendations

ISSUES WITH CURRENT REPORTING SYSYTEM Reports are not fully aligned with the NYS standards Reports do not reflect the updated math and ELA initiatives Reports lack K – 5 alignment 10 minute conferences do not provide adequate discussion time for parents and teachers. Skill sets are not fully addressed in reports Goals are not established in reports Reports lack information on social skills and interpersonal development

PROCESS OF RE-EVALUATION Formation of K -5 report card committee Review of teacher and parent comments / recommendations Review of NYS standards in the content areas Review of the social / developmental component Gathering of exemplar reports from other districts Group input into new/additional indicators Produce a new K- 5 reporting system for approval by the BOE.

GOALS To create a reporting system that: Improves content area reporting for parents Is aligned K – 5 Aligns with NYS Standards Assess social, emotional and character education growth Avoids “teacher speak.” Provides electronic access for teachers and possibly parents. Provides goals for students

Recommendations Change current reporting system from one short (10 minute) conference and three written reports to two longer (20 minute) conferences and two written reports. Expand indicators to provide greater detail in report Align performance levels to match State Standards on a 1 – 4 scale Develop electronic reports for easy editing and possible transmission
